Avon and Somerset Police have recovered a stolen puppy overnight.

Maxi, the 16-week-old French bulldog puppy, was stolen in a burglary at his owner’s Watchet home between midday and 4pm on Monday, July 20.

The family saw him advertised on an online selling site later that night and immediately alerted the police.

A spokesperson from Avon and Somerset Police said: "Response officers followed up the lead, recovering Maxi and making an arrest at about 2.30am today, Tuesday July 21.

"The puppy is now safely back home.

A 34-year-old man arrested on suspicion of burglary has been released under investigation pending further enquiries."

Maxi's family said: “Maxi is a member of the family and we’re absolutely ecstatic to have him returned home safely.”
